Output fcedc76391c79518f4f881b31168a61f0e1df88018e072332dc4fc332b018403:0

value
1520178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 566d4b289b4cdf8e38a0b7a47a7b8d5312664755 OP_EQUAL
address
39ZzxtjhCXoqMMGMCppgU3j9PVNQRuH1nT
transaction
fcedc76391c79518f4f881b31168a61f0e1df88018e072332dc4fc332b018403
spent
true